Purina remembers prescription dog food including extreme levels of vitamin D

Nestlé Purina PetCare Company is willingly remembering choose great deals of Purina Pro Plan Veterinary Diets EL Elemental (PPVD EL) prescription dry dog food due to possibly raised levels of vitamin D.

Purina said it started the recall after getting 2 contacts about 2 different verified cases of a dog displaying indications of vitamin D toxicity after taking in the diet plan. The business said that as soon as they were removed the diet plan, both dogs recuperated.

“Vitamin D is an essential nutrient for dogs; however, ingestion of elevated levels can lead to health issues depending on the level of vitamin D and the length of exposure. Vitamin D toxicity may include vomiting, loss of appetite, increased thirst, increased urination, and excessive drooling to renal (kidney) dysfunction,” the business said in a release.

The impacted dry dog food was dispersed throughout the United States by prescription just through veterinary centers, Purina Vet Direct, Purina for Professionals, and other choose merchants with the capability to verify a prescription.

Bags of PPVD EL with the UPC Code and Production Code listed below ought to be instantly disposed of.

Product UPC Code Production Code
Purina Pro Plan Veterinary Diets EL Elemental (PPVD EL)

8 pound and 20 pound bags
38100 19190 – 8 pound

38100 19192 – 20 pound
2249 1082

2250 1082

2276 1082

2277 1082

2290 1082

2360 1082

2361 1082

Pet owners who acquired bags of the item noted above are asked to instantly stop feeding and toss it away in a container where no other animals, consisting of wildlife, can get to it. If indications such as weight-loss, extreme drooling, throwing up, anorexia nervosa or increased thirst or urination have actually happened in their dog while consuming this diet plan, animal owners ought to call their vet.

No other Purina animal care items are impacted.

Veterinary and other retail partners ought to get rid of and damage the afflicted item from their stock.

“We ask forgiveness to animal owners and vets for any issues or trouble this scenario has actually triggered,” Purina said. “As animal professionals and animal owners ourselves, the health and wellness of animals is our leading concern.”
